Functional finish of hemp fabric with vanillin/fluorosilicone waterborne polyurethane

    Vanillin/fluorosilicone-modified waterborne polyurethane emulsion is prepared by stepwise polymerization using hydroxy silicone oil, perfluorooctanol and vanillin as modified monomers, and is applied to finishing of hemp fabric.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y confirm the successful grafting of fluorosilicon chain segments and vanillin. Scanning electron microscopy observation shows that a uniform and dense protective film is formed on the fiber surface. The performance test results show that the water contact angle of the finished fabric reaches 141.44°, showing excellent hydrophobicity. The antibacterial test shows that the inhibition rate of Escherichia. coli and Staphylococcus aureus are 98.9% and 99.9%, respectively. At the same time, the breaking strength and breaking elongation are improved, and the finished hemp fabric has good UV resistance and stain resistance.
